To convert the decimal IP address 131.9.202.111 to binary format, each decimal octet is converted to an 8-bit binary number. This results in: 131 (10000011), 9 (00001001), 202 (11001010), and 111 (01101111). Therefore, the binary format for the IP address 131.9.202.111 is 10000011.00001001.11001010.01101111.
